Associate G&A Project Manager

ARMRA is a company focused on restoring health through its innovative product ARMRA Colostrum. The Associate G&A Project Manager will support day-to-day execution across G&A teams, ensuring smooth operations and consistent follow-through on initiatives.

Consumer GoodsDietary SupplementsFood and BeverageHealth CareRetail

Responsibilities

Project Management: Manage daily project tasks, timelines, and updates across G&A teams
SOP Management: Maintain existing SOPs and coordinate review and approval processes
Request Management: Serve as the point of intake for software and license requests, coordinating evaluations and approvals
Knowledge Management: Support Guru upkeep and uploading to ensure content remains accurate, current, and accessible
Onboarding & Training: Support process training for new employees (e.g., Guru, Monday.com, Slack, Calendaring), with agendas developed in collaboration with the Director of G&A Operations
Tool Proficiency: Act as a subject-matter resource for PM tools, supporting day-to-day questions and driving upskilling across teams
Legal Operations: Train as backup to launch legal workflows and pull repository insights in our CLM tool
